  Airman and Family Readiness Center  

 
 
The Airman and Family Readiness Center (A&FRC) is located at 7601 Randall Avenue. Hours of operation are Monday through Friday, 7:30 a.m. to 4:30 p.m. They offer many programs to support single and married active duty military, guard, reserve, DoD civilian employees, retirees, and all family members.
The A&FRC has two resource rooms available for use. Clients may use computers to access internet, accomplish on-line banking, type resumes, perform job searches, etc. The resource rooms also contain a vast collection of literature to assist clients with all aspects of the military lifestyle.
The School Liaison program assists base leadership and command with key parent and school concerns, disseminates school information to military families, and informs school personnel on issues relevant to the military member’s school attendance including transition and deployment. The center’s Readiness NCO assists deployed members and their families and includes Hearts Apart morale calls, Hearts Apart social groups, Give Parents a Break childcare, Car Care Because We Care, video phone, free calling cards, and supervisor training covering deployed troops.
The Career Focus program area assists members and their families with resumes, job searches, skills improvement classes, and annual career fairs. The Transition Assistance program provides pre-separation counseling and hosts a three day Department of Labor transition assistance workshop for members separating or retiring.
A Personal Financial program helps members and their families with financial issues to include debt management and investment opportunities. The Air Force Aid Society (AFAS) provides financial assistance for unexpected travel emergencies, dental and medical expenses, and also supports programs such as Bundles for Babies and respite care. AFAS utilizes Operation Warmheart to assist in emergencies not covered by AFAS policies.
The Information and Referral program coordinates and provides local and nationwide information to assist families in finding needed resources for resolving problems or issues. The Relocation Assistance area helps members who are arriving or departing the installation and includes programs such as 90th Wing Right Start, Military Spouse Orientation Tours, sponsorship training, Kids Move Too and Smooth Move, Child Care for PCS, and maintains the Military HomeFront website for F.E. Warren AFB.
The Family Life Education program coordinates the Key Spouse Program and assists families with work and life issues and also interfaces with on- and off-base community resource agencies in support of the military family.
F.E. Warren has an impressive loan closet and Airman’s Attic programs. The Loan Closet loans free of charge household items for those members in a PCS status or for permanent party households. Loans range from 7 to 30 days. Hours of operation are Monday - Friday, 10 a.m. - 2 p.m. The Airman’s Attic is for E-4s and below and their family members. This is similar to a free thrift shop and donations are accepted. Hours of operation are the second and fourth Saturdays of the months from 8 a.m. - noon and the facility is located at 6900 Diamond Creek Way. They also have a satellite Women, Infants, and Children (WIC) office for the military family’s convenience.
